Tony Smith, my friend and the driving force behind Starship Sofa, has launched a workshop series for aspiring SF authors. The first one will be held on 12 March, online, and live. There’s a pretty respectable lineup and series of topics planned: The Beginning – Gregory Frost Plot Tricks from the Dark Side – James Patrick Kelly How To Fix Your Story After It’s Written and You Discover That It Doesn’t Work – Michael Swanwick Why Writing Groups – Mercurio …
